DataGridViewColumn.HeaderText Propriedade

Definição

Obtém ou define o texto de legenda na célula do cabeçalho da coluna.

public:
 property System::String ^ HeaderText { System::String ^ get(); void set(System::String ^ value); };
public string HeaderText { get; set; }
member this.HeaderText : string with get, set
Public Property HeaderText As String

Valor da propriedade

Um String com o texto desejado. O padrão é uma cadeia de caracteres vazia ("").

Exemplos

O exemplo de código a seguir usa a HeaderText propriedade para alterar o texto no cabeçalho da coluna. Este exemplo de código faz parte de um exemplo maior fornecido para a DataGridViewColumn classe .

// Change the text in the column header.
void Button9_Click( Object^ /*sender*/, EventArgs^ /*args*/ )
{
   IEnumerator^ myEnum2 = dataGridView->Columns->GetEnumerator();
   while ( myEnum2->MoveNext() )
   {
      DataGridViewColumn^ column = safe_cast<DataGridViewColumn^>(myEnum2->Current);
      column->HeaderText = String::Concat( L"Column ", column->Index.ToString() );
   }
}
// Change the text in the column header.
private void Button9_Click(object sender,
    EventArgs args)
{
    foreach (DataGridViewColumn column in dataGridView.Columns)
    {

        column.HeaderText = String.Concat("Column ",
            column.Index.ToString());
    }
}
' Change the text in the column header.
Private Sub Button9_Click(ByVal sender As Object, _
    ByVal args As EventArgs) Handles Button9.Click

    For Each column As DataGridViewColumn _
        In dataGridView.Columns

        column.HeaderText = String.Concat("Column ", _
            column.Index.ToString)
    Next
End Sub

Comentários

Essa propriedade é útil somente quando a coluna tem uma célula de cabeçalho associada. Para obter mais informações, consulte a propriedade HeaderCellCore.

Observação

Não há nenhuma propriedade de texto de cabeçalho correspondente para linhas. Para exibir rótulos em cabeçalhos de linha, você deve manipular o DataGridView.CellPainting evento e pintar seus próprios rótulos quando DataGridViewCellPaintingEventArgs.ColumnIndex for -1.

Aplica-se a

Confira também